The single idea here is that @hydra.main looks for a config in the ConfigStore instance, cs named "mnistconf". It finds the MNISTConf (our top level conf) we registered to that name and populates cfg inside main() with the fully expanded structured config. This includes our optimizer and scheduler … See more For clarity, as we modify the PyTorch MNIST example, we will make the diffs explicit. Most of the changes we introduce will be at the top of the file within the commented ##### HYDRA BLOCK #####, though in … See more In this tutorial, we demonstrated the path of least resistance to configuring your existing PyTorch code with Hydra. The main benefits we get from the 'Basic' level are: 1. No more … See more Now that we've defined all of our configs, we just need to let Hydra create our cfg object at runtime and make sure the cfgis plumbed to any … See more That's it. Since the @hydra.main decorator is above def main(cfg), Hydra will manage the command line, logging, and saving outputs to a … See more WebMar 31, 2024 · import hydra from hydra.core.config_store import ConfigStore from src.config import RecordingConfig cs = ConfigStore.instance() …
Using Hydra Configuration inside Classes - Stack Overflow
WebApr 11, 2024 · In the Google Cloud console, go to the VM Instances page. Go to the Compute Engine instances page. Click Create Instance and configure the instance as … WebFind the best open-source package for your project with Snyk Open Source Advisor. Explore over 1 million open source packages. e4gw91 location
Minimal example Hydra
Webcs = ConfigStore. instance # Registering the Config class with the name `postgresql` with the config group `db` cs. store (name = "postgresql", group = "db", node = … WebJun 16, 2024 · config_name= "example" cs= ConfigStore.instance () cs.store (name=config_name, node=Config) cs.store (group='data_conf', name='csv_images', node=DatasetConfig) config. そして DataSetConfig このようにして定義されています。 @dataclass class Config: data: Any= MISSING @dataclass class DatasetConfig: a: str= … WebMar 10, 2024 · if __name__ == '__main__': config_name = "csv_images_test" cs = ConfigStore.instance () cs.store (name=config_name, node=Config) @hydra.main (config_path="/hdd/twapi/configs/", config_name=config_name) def main (cfg: Config) -> None: print (OmegaConf.to_yaml (cfg)) main () e4 dictionary\u0027s